Tripoli: The mayor of Sabha has assigned the mukhtars of the neighborhoods to assess the damage caused by the rainfall in the city's neighborhoods. This came in a notice published by the Sabha Municipal Council today, Sunday, on its Facebook page. Earlier today, the National Center for Meteorology said, today, Sunday, that the amount of rain that fell on the city of Sabha amounted to 63 mm. According to the Sabha Municipal Council, the rain led to at least two deaths and 33 others were injured, stressing the need to exercise caution. The center expected the sky to be partly cloudy, increasing from time to time, with the possibility of thunderstorms falling on some areas in the southwest this evening, especially "Ghat - Qatrun - Al-Barakat - Akakus Mountains - border areas with Algeria", which causes valleys to flow.
